Rapper Rod Wave is once again throwing a giant birthday party.

Rodarius Marcell Green, a  St. Petersburg-born superstar from  Lakewood High School, announced this morning that his annual Birthday Bash will once again go down at Tampa's Amalie Arena on Saturday, August 24, at 7 p.m.

Tickets go on sale Friday, June 28, at 10:00 a.m. on Ticketmaster.com.

As usual, the full lineup has yet to be announced, but like the previous b-day parties, there's usually a heavy roster of "mystery guests."

Known for an emotional style of rap and pop, Mr. “Street Runner” has the unique pleasure of joining mega-pop star Taylor Swift as the only two artists to top the Billboard 200 for the past three years.
